How to Choose Christmas Gifts for Your Wife
Start with the version of luxury she actually enjoys. Some wives want a quiet evening made more special with dessert and candlelight. Others love discovering new flavors, receiving something exquisitely wrapped, or making a memory outside the house. The right choice depends less on a price point than on her rituals, preferences, and personality.
Consider what she reaches for when she is treating herself. Does she keep beautiful sweets for guests but rarely save them for herself? Does she value an elegant home, time together, wellness, fashion, or a meaningful keepsake? A Christmas gift becomes more personal when it meets her where she already finds joy.

2. Baklava for a Christmas Eve Dessert Ritual
Rather than saving all the sweetness for Christmas Day, give her a beautiful baklava assortment to open on Christmas Eve. Serve it after dinner with coffee, tea, or a glass of sparkling wine, then put phones away for an hour. The gift is not only the pastry. It is the invitation to make a calm, delicious ritual together.
Look for baklava made with fine layers of phyllo, generous nuts, and balanced syrup. Quality matters here. A too-sweet, heavy version misses the crisp, elegant character that makes great baklava feel celebratory.
3. Personalized Jewelry With a Private Meaning
Jewelry remains a classic for good reason, but the details distinguish a lasting gift from a generic one. A discreet initial, a meaningful date, the coordinates of a favorite place, or a stone in a color she wears often can give even a simple piece emotional weight.
This option is best if you know her style well. If she favors minimal gold, a dramatic statement necklace may spend its life in a drawer. When in doubt, choose a beautifully made, understated design and pair it with a handwritten note explaining why you chose it.
4. A Fragrance That Feels Like Her
Perfume is intimate, luxurious, and wonderfully festive to unwrap. If she already has a signature scent, a special edition or complementary body product is a confident choice. If you are choosing something new, use the fragrances she wears as your guide rather than selecting based on the bottle alone.
Warm amber, soft rose, vanilla, citrus, and wood notes can all be beautiful winter options, but fragrance is deeply personal. This is a strong gift when you know her taste. It is a riskier one when you do not.
5. A Cashmere Layer for Winter Mornings
A fine cashmere wrap, cardigan, or scarf offers the rare combination of practicality and indulgence. It is something she can wear immediately, whether she is reading by the window, traveling after the holidays, or heading out for a festive dinner.
Choose a color already present in her wardrobe. Cream, charcoal, camel, black, and deep burgundy are usually versatile, while a bright shade works when she enjoys color. Check fabric composition carefully. A soft hand feel and thoughtful construction are worth more than a trend-led design.
6. An At-Home Spa Evening, Properly Done
An at-home spa gift can feel thoughtful rather than ordinary when it is built around her specific idea of rest. Think beautiful bath salts, a rich body cream, a plush robe, and her favorite tea. Add a plate of delicate sweets and create the atmosphere before you give the gift.
The key is not giving her more chores disguised as self-care. Run the bath, arrange the tray, and protect the time. A gesture of care lands differently when she does not have to organize it herself.
7. A Cooking Class or Tasting Experience for Two
For wives who value experiences over possessions, book an evening that gives you both something new to enjoy. A cooking class, wine tasting, pottery workshop, or chef-led dinner creates a memory with more staying power than many objects.
Make it feel complete by including the date and plan in the card. If the event is weeks away, add a small immediate treat, such as a box of premium confections, so she has something beautiful to open on Christmas morning.
8. A Thoughtful Book and a Reading Escape
A first edition by a favorite author is special, but a carefully chosen new release can be just as meaningful. Consider a novel she has mentioned, a design book for her coffee table, a cookbook from a cuisine she loves, or a collection of essays that suits her curiosity.
Turn it into a true gift set with a fine bookmark, cozy throw, and a few sweets for a late-night reading break. This works especially well for the wife whose ideal luxury is uninterrupted time with a great book.
9. A Printed Photo Book of Your Year
Digital photos are easy to take and surprisingly easy to lose in the scroll. A printed photo book gives your shared year a permanent place. Include ordinary moments as well as big ones: morning walks, restaurant tables, family celebrations, and the candid pictures that make her laugh.
Keep the captions short and sincere. A photo book does not need to be perfect to be moving. Its power comes from showing her that you noticed the life you are building together.
10. A Beautiful Home Piece She Would Choose Herself
A sculptural vase, hand-thrown serving bowl, framed art print, or elegant candle can be a wonderful gift if she cares about her home. The challenge is taste. Choose only if you understand her aesthetic and know where the piece might live.
For a more personal presentation, fill a serving bowl with Turkish sweets before wrapping it. She receives something lasting for her home, plus a generous holiday indulgence to enjoy immediately.
11. A Subscription That Extends the Celebration
A monthly flower delivery, specialty tea club, magazine subscription, or curated food box gives Christmas a longer afterglow. This is an excellent choice for someone who loves small delights arriving throughout the year.
Be selective about the commitment. A subscription should feel like a pleasure, not more clutter. Choose a category she already enjoys, and make sure its cadence suits her lifestyle.
12. A Planned Day With Nothing for Her to Manage
One of the most generous gifts is a day designed around her, with no logistics left on her shoulders. Arrange breakfast, transportation, reservations, and the small details she usually handles. It might include a museum visit, a favorite lunch, a massage, or simply an unhurried afternoon at home.
Present the plan beautifully, then follow through. Thoughtfulness is often most visible in the preparation no one sees.
